In this review the NICETOWN 100% Blackout Blinds panels are evaluated for people who need full darkness and temperature control from a ready-made curtain. The set comes as two large panels (70 in x 108 in each, 140 in total width) with silver grommets for easy hanging, and the single biggest reason to buy is the genuine sewn-in blackout liner that creates a near-pitch-dark room and noticeably reduces drafts and heat transfer. For bedrooms, media rooms or a laundry room patio sliding door, these curtains focus on light blocking and insulation rather than decorative trimming.
Key Features
- Ready Made Size: Each package includes two panels, each 70 in wide x 108 in long, giving a total width of 140 in to cover large windows or sliding doors.
- Blackout Effect: Sewn-in black liner backing blocks sunlight and UV rays to create a dark environment for daytime sleeping or bright-screen viewing.
- Thermal Insulation: Triple weave fabric and the lined construction help balance room temperature by insulating against summer heat and winter chill.
- Noise Reducing: Heavyweight, two-layer construction increases sound absorption over single-layer curtains, helping reduce household noise.
- Easy Install: Large silver grommets with a 1.6 in inner diameter make the panels simple to hang and slide along standard rods.
- Low Maintenance: Polyester fabric is machine washable with mild detergent and low temp ironing for years of use.
Who It's For
The NICETOWN blackout panels are best for homeowners and renters who need serious light blocking and improved thermal performance without custom tailoring; they suit bedrooms, media rooms, and sliding glass doors where a dark, quiet environment is desired. The heavy-weight, lined panels also appeal to people wanting an insulated curtain to reduce heating and cooling load or to block streetlight for shift workers or nap times.
Those who want custom lengths, patterned decorative drapery or a sheer layer for visible daylight diffusion should look elsewhere, since these panels prioritize blackout performance and a classic grommet top rather than ornamental detail or semi-sheer light filtering.

Specifications
| Brand | NICETOWN |
| Material | Polyester, triple weave with sewn-in blackout liner |
| Package Contents | 2 panels per package (ready made) |
| Panel Size | 70 in x 108 in each (total width 140 in) |
| Grommet Diameter | 1.6 in inner diameter silver grommets |
| Care | Machine washable below 86F, mild detergent, no bleach, low temp iron |

Frequently Asked Questions
Do these curtains really block all light?
Yes; the sewn-in black liner and heavyweight triple weave construction create a very dark room when panels are fully closed.
Can I machine wash these panels?
Yes; they are machine washable with water below 86F using mild detergent and should be ironed at low temperature.
Will they fit a sliding glass patio door?
Yes; each panel is 70 in wide and the set provides 140 in total width, which suits most large patio sliding doors when hung with a sufficiently long rod.
